Native American Magnet is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Buffalo, Erie County. The school has 345 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Buffalo City School District school district. It serves grades Pre-Kโ8 in an urban setting. The school employs 34.6 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 10.0:1. 15% of students are proficient in reading.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.
Native American Magnet enrolls 345 students across grades Pre-Kโ8. The student body is 51% male and 49% female. A teaching staff of 34.6 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 10.0: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 43% Black or African American, 18% Asian and 15% Hispanic or Latino.

314 of the school's 345 students (91%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 314 qualify for free lunch and 0 for a reduced price.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Native American Magnet is located in an urban setting (NCES locale: City, Large).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. Native American Magnet is one of 60 schools in BUFFALO CITY SCHOOL DISTRICT, based in BUFFALO, New York. The district serves 30,077 students district-wide and employs 2,964 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 345 students, Native American Magnet is smaller than the district average of about 501 students per school.
